Package dev.cerbos.api.v1.policy
Interface PolicyOuterClass.TestResults.DetailsOrBuilder
-
- All Superinterfaces:
com.google.protobuf.MessageLiteOrBuilder,com.google.protobuf.MessageOrBuilder
- All Known Implementing Classes:
PolicyOuterClass.TestResults.Details,PolicyOuterClass.TestResults.Details.Builder
- Enclosing class:
- PolicyOuterClass.TestResults
public static interface PolicyOuterClass.TestResults.DetailsOrBuilder extends com.google.protobuf.MessageOrBuilder
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description Engine.TracegetEngineTrace(int index)repeated .cerbos.engine.v1.Trace engine_trace = 4;intgetEngineTraceCount()repeated .cerbos.engine.v1.Trace engine_trace = 4;java.util.List<Engine.Trace>getEngineTraceList()repeated .cerbos.engine.v1.Trace engine_trace = 4;Engine.TraceOrBuildergetEngineTraceOrBuilder(int index)repeated .cerbos.engine.v1.Trace engine_trace = 4;java.util.List<? extends Engine.TraceOrBuilder>getEngineTraceOrBuilderList()repeated .cerbos.engine.v1.Trace engine_trace = 4;java.lang.StringgetError()string error = 3;com.google.protobuf.ByteStringgetErrorBytes()string error = 3;PolicyOuterClass.TestResults.FailuregetFailure().cerbos.policy.v1.TestResults.Failure failure = 2;PolicyOuterClass.TestResults.FailureOrBuildergetFailureOrBuilder().cerbos.policy.v1.TestResults.Failure failure = 2;PolicyOuterClass.TestResults.Details.OutcomeCasegetOutcomeCase()PolicyOuterClass.TestResults.ResultgetResult().cerbos.policy.v1.TestResults.Result result = 1;intgetResultValue().cerbos.policy.v1.TestResults.Result result = 1;PolicyOuterClass.TestResults.SuccessgetSuccess().cerbos.policy.v1.TestResults.Success success = 5;PolicyOuterClass.TestResults.SuccessOrBuildergetSuccessOrBuilder().cerbos.policy.v1.TestResults.Success success = 5;booleanhasError()string error = 3;booleanhasFailure().cerbos.policy.v1.TestResults.Failure failure = 2;booleanhasSuccess().cerbos.policy.v1.TestResults.Success success = 5;-
Methods inherited from interface com.google.protobuf.MessageOrBuilder
findInitializationErrors, getAllFields, getDefaultInstanceForType, getDescriptorForType,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of
-
-
-
-
Method Detail
-
getResultValue
int getResultValue()
.cerbos.policy.v1.TestResults.Result result = 1;- Returns:
- The enum numeric value on the wire for result.
-
getResult
PolicyOuterClass.TestResults.Result getResult()
.cerbos.policy.v1.TestResults.Result result = 1;- Returns:
- The result.
-
hasFailure
boolean hasFailure()
.cerbos.policy.v1.TestResults.Failure failure = 2;- Returns:
- Whether the failure field is set.
-
getFailure
PolicyOuterClass.TestResults.Failure getFailure()
.cerbos.policy.v1.TestResults.Failure failure = 2;- Returns:
- The failure.
-
getFailureOrBuilder
PolicyOuterClass.TestResults.FailureOrBuilder getFailureOrBuilder()
.cerbos.policy.v1.TestResults.Failure failure = 2;
-
hasError
boolean hasError()
string error = 3;- Returns:
- Whether the error field is set.
-
getError
java.lang.String getError()
string error = 3;- Returns:
- The error.
-
getErrorBytes
com.google.protobuf.ByteString getErrorBytes()
string error = 3;- Returns:
- The bytes for error.
-
hasSuccess
boolean hasSuccess()
.cerbos.policy.v1.TestResults.Success success = 5;- Returns:
- Whether the success field is set.
-
getSuccess
PolicyOuterClass.TestResults.Success getSuccess()
.cerbos.policy.v1.TestResults.Success success = 5;- Returns:
- The success.
-
getSuccessOrBuilder
PolicyOuterClass.TestResults.SuccessOrBuilder getSuccessOrBuilder()
.cerbos.policy.v1.TestResults.Success success = 5;
-
getEngineTraceList
java.util.List<Engine.Trace> getEngineTraceList()
repeated .cerbos.engine.v1.Trace engine_trace = 4;
-
getEngineTrace
Engine.Trace getEngineTrace(int index)
repeated .cerbos.engine.v1.Trace engine_trace = 4;
-
getEngineTraceCount
int getEngineTraceCount()
repeated .cerbos.engine.v1.Trace engine_trace = 4;
-
getEngineTraceOrBuilderList
java.util.List<? extends Engine.TraceOrBuilder> getEngineTraceOrBuilderList()
repeated .cerbos.engine.v1.Trace engine_trace = 4;
-
getEngineTraceOrBuilder
Engine.TraceOrBuilder getEngineTraceOrBuilder(int index)
repeated .cerbos.engine.v1.Trace engine_trace = 4;
-
getOutcomeCase
PolicyOuterClass.TestResults.Details.OutcomeCase getOutcomeCase()
-
-